Rumah Sakit Mitra Medika - Visits Stats

34 3 2 1
Visit Id Visitor Id User Date (UTC) Location IP
939068730
17 Mar, 2026, 02:06:39 216.73.216.48
937751477
05 Mar, 2026, 00:41:19 74.7.241.54
Page 1 of 1. (Total: 2 Items)